В современном мире развитие информационных технологий и интернета стало неотъемлемой частью нашей жизни. Каждый день мы сталкиваемся с веб-страницами, которые не только предоставляют нам информацию, но и обладают прекрасным дизайном и функциональностью.
Однако, чтобы создавать такие красивые и удобные веб-страницы, необходимо обладать знаниями и навыками в области верстки. Именно поэтому многие начинающие разработчики и дизайнеры стремятся изучить основы верстки и веб-дизайна.
Книга «Уильямс р книга по верстке для начинающих» является отличным ресурсом для тех, кто только начинает свой путь в веб-разработке. В ней автор детально описывает основные принципы верстки, объясняет, как создавать красивый и современный дизайн веб-страницы, и рассказывает о самых популярных инструментах и технологиях.
“Уильямс р книга по верстке для начинающих” – это не просто справочник с теоретическими материалами, но и практическое пособие, которое предлагает множество упражнений и примеров для самостоятельного изучения и тренировки навыков. Таким образом, читатель сможет не только получить теоретические знания, но и непосредственно попрактиковаться в создании веб-страниц.
Если вы только начинаете свой путь в веб-разработке и ищете хороший и понятный учебник, то книга «Уильямс р книга по верстке для начинающих» является отличным выбором для вас. Она поможет вам освоить основы верстки, научит вас создавать красивый дизайн и функциональные веб-страницы, и даст возможность попрактиковаться в новых навыках.
- Уильямс р книга
- По верстке
- Введение в верстку для начинающих
- Основы верстки
- Изучение HTML
- CSS для начинающих
- Продвинутые техники
- Макеты и сетки
- Адаптивная верстка
- Веб-разработка
- Вопрос-ответ
- Какую тему освещает книга Уильямс Р «Верстка для начинающих»?
- Для какого уровня читателей предназначена книга Уильямс Р «Верстка для начинающих»?
- Что включает в себя книга Уильямс Р «Верстка для начинающих»?
- Можно ли использовать книгу Уильямс Р «Верстка для начинающих» для самостоятельного обучения?
Уильямс р книга
Уильямс р книга по верстке для начинающих является отличным руководством, которое позволяет овладеть основными принципами верстки и создания веб-страниц. Книга написана понятным и доступным языком, что делает ее идеальным выбором для новичков в веб-разработке.
В книге Уильямс р подробно рассматривает основные технологии и инструменты, используемые в верстке. Он начинает с основ HTML и CSS и постепенно переходит к более сложным концепциям, таким как адаптивный дизайн и мобильная верстка.
- HTML: Уильямс р подробно объясняет основные теги и свойства HTML, их использование и влияние на структуру веб-страницы.
- CSS: В книге также представлены основы CSS, включая селекторы, свойства и значения. Уильямс р объясняет, как использовать CSS для стилизации элементов и создания привлекательного дизайна.
- Адаптивный дизайн: Важной частью книги является раздел, посвященный адаптивному дизайну. Уильямс р описывает различные техники и подходы к созданию мобильных и планшетных версий веб-страницы.
В конце книги Уильямс р предлагает практические упражнения и проекты, которые позволяют читателям применить полученные знания на практике и закрепить их.
Общий формат книги Уильямс р по верстке очень удобен и позволяет быстро находить нужные сведения. Каждый раздел сопровождается примерами кода и наглядными иллюстрациями, что облегчает понимание материала.
В целом, книга Уильямс р по верстке для начинающих является идеальным ресурсом для тех, кто только начинает свой путь в веб-разработке. Она обеспечивает все необходимые знания и навыки для создания стильных и функциональных веб-страниц.
По верстке
Верстка веб-страниц — это процесс создания структуры, расположения и внешнего вида контента на веб-странице с помощью HTML и CSS.
HTML (HyperText Markup Language) используется для определения структуры и содержимого веб-страницы. С помощью HTML можно создавать заголовки, параграфы, списки, таблицы и другие элементы контента.
CSS (Cascading Style Sheets) используется для определения внешнего вида веб-страницы. С помощью CSS можно задавать цвета, шрифты, размеры элементов, выравнивание и многие другие свойства.
Верстка веб-страницы обычно начинается с создания её структуры с использованием тегов HTML. Затем с помощью CSS добавляется стилизация для придания странице желаемого внешнего вида.
Основные теги HTML для верстки:
- <h1> — заголовок первого уровня
- <p> — абзац
- <ul> — маркированный список
- <ol> — нумерованный список
- <li> — элемент списка
- <table> — таблица
Основные свойства CSS для верстки:
- color — цвет текста
- font-family — шрифт
- font-size — размер шрифта
- text-align — выравнивание текста
- background-color — цвет фона
- margin — отступы от элемента
Хорошая верстка веб-страницы помогает улучшить её доступность, удобство использования и визуальное впечатление. Хорошо структурированный и стилизованный контент также может способствовать улучшению позиций в поисковых системах.
Введение в верстку для начинающих
Верстка — это процесс создания структуры и внешнего вида веб-страницы или документа. Верстка может включать в себя разметку текста, выбор шрифтов, цветовых схем, расположение элементов и добавление изображений.
При обучении верстке для начинающих, важно понять основы HTML — языка разметки гипертекста. HTML используется для создания структуры веб-страницы. Элементы HTML обозначаются с помощью тегов, таких как <p>, <strong>, <em>, <ul> и т. д.
При верстке важно помнить о семантической разметке. Это означает использование тегов HTML в соответствии с их семантическим значением. Например, используйте тег <h1> для заголовка страницы, <p> для обычного текста и <ul> для списка без упорядоченности.
Также важно учитывать доступность страницы для пользователей с ограниченными возможностями. Это означает использование корректных заголовков, альтернативного текста для изображений и других методов, которые помогут пользователям считывать и понимать содержимое страницы.
Для создания сложных структур на странице можно использовать теги <table>. Тег <table> позволяет создавать таблицы с различными ячейками и стилями. Однако, таблицы следует использовать только для представления семантической информации, а не для верстки макетов.
Итак, начинающим верстальщикам рекомендуется изучить основы HTML и понять принципы семантической разметки. Затем можно изучить CSS — язык таблиц стилей, который позволит создавать визуальное оформление для веб-страницы. Практика и постоянное обучение помогут совершенствоваться в верстке и создавать качественные и доступные веб-страницы.
Основы верстки
Верстка веб-страницы — это процесс создания структуры и оформления контента с помощью языка разметки HTML и каскадных таблиц стилей CSS. Верстка позволяет организовать информацию на веб-странице в удобном и понятном виде для пользователей.
Основные принципы верстки:
- Структурированность — правильная организация контента на странице с использованием тегов HTML.
- Семантичность — использование соответствующих тегов для разметки контента, которые отражают его смысл.
- Доступность — создание веб-страницы, которую смогут использовать люди с ограниченными возможностями.
- Адаптивность — создание веб-страницы, которая будет правильно отображаться на различных устройствах и экранах.
HTML позволяет создавать структуру веб-страницы с помощью различных тегов, таких как:
- <h1> — <h6> — заголовки различного уровня, используются для выделения важных частей страницы.
- <p> — параграф, используется для оформления текста.
- <strong> — выделение текста жирным шрифтом, используется для подчеркивания важности содержимого.
- <em> — выделение текста курсивом, используется для подчеркивания эмоционального оттенка.
- <ul> — маркированный список, используется для перечисления элементов без порядка.
- <ol> — нумерованный список, используется для перечисления элементов с порядком.
- <li> — элемент списка, используется внутри тегов <ul> и <ol> для указания каждого элемента списка.
- <table> — таблица, используется для организации данных в табличном виде.
Это лишь базовые теги HTML, с помощью которых можно создавать простую веб-страницу. Для более сложных задач существуют и другие теги и атрибуты.
Изучение HTML
HTML (HyperText Markup Language) — это язык разметки, который используется для создания веб-страниц. Изучение HTML является важным шагом для всех, кто хочет стать веб-разработчиком, создавать собственные сайты или работать в сфере веб-дизайна.
Основы HTML:
- HTML основан на тегах. Теги определяют структуру и содержимое веб-страницы.
- В HTML используются открывающие и закрывающие теги для обозначения начала и конца элемента.
- Каждый элемент может содержать атрибуты, которые задают дополнительные свойства элемента, такие как цвет, размер, ссылки и т. д.
Основные теги HTML:
<html>
: определяет начало и конец HTML документа.<head>
: содержит информацию о документе, такую как заголовок, мета-теги и ссылки на стили.<title>
: задает заголовок документа, который отображается в шапке окна браузера.<body>
: определяет тело документа, содержит содержимое веб-страницы, такое как текст, изображения, таблицы и ссылки.<p>
: определяет абзац текста.<strong>
: выделяет текст жирным шрифтом.<em>
: выделяет текст курсивом.<ol>
: создает нумерованный список.<ul>
: создает маркированный список.<li>
: определяет элемент списка.<table>
: создает таблицу.
Изучение HTML требует практики и терпения. С помощью HTML вы можете создавать красивые и функциональные веб-страницы, а также усовершенствовать их с помощью CSS и JavaScript.
CSS для начинающих
CSS (Cascading Style Sheets) — это язык стилей, используемый для оформления веб-страниц и создания красивого дизайна. С помощью CSS можно изменять цвета, шрифты, размеры и расположение элементов на веб-странице.
Для использования CSS нужно создать файл стилей с расширением .css и подключить его к HTML-документу с помощью тега <link>. Также можно использовать встроенный CSS, добавляя стилевые правила внутри тега <style> внутри раздела <head> документа.
В CSS используются селекторы, которые позволяют выбирать конкретные элементы на странице. Селекторы могут быть простыми, например, <p> для выбора всех абзацев, или составными, такими как <div.class> для выбора элементов с определенным классом. С помощью селекторов можно задать стили для выбранных элементов.
Стандартные свойства CSS позволяют задавать различные параметры стиля, такие как цвет фона, шрифт, отступы, границы и прочие атрибуты. Некоторые из наиболее часто используемых свойств:
- background-color: устанавливает цвет фона элемента;
- font-family: устанавливает шрифт для текста;
- color: устанавливает цвет текста;
- margin: задает отступы вокруг элемента;
- border: задает стиль, ширину и цвет границы элемента;
- padding: задает отступы между содержимым элемента и границей;
В CSS также можно создавать классы и идентификаторы для элементов и применять к ним стили с помощью селекторов. Классы задаются с помощью точки «.», а идентификаторы с помощью символа «#». Например, класс .highlight может быть применен к нескольким элементам на странице, а идентификатор #header может быть применен только к одному элементу.
Таблицы также могут быть оформлены с помощью CSS. Свойства, такие как border-collapse и text-align, позволяют устанавливать стили для таблиц и их содержимого.
Это лишь небольшая часть возможностей CSS для оформления веб-страниц. Изучение CSS является важным шагом для каждого начинающего веб-разработчика и поможет в создании привлекательного и структурированного дизайна ваших веб-проектов.
Продвинутые техники
Продвинутые техники верстки позволяют создавать более сложные и интерактивные веб-сайты. Ниже представлены некоторые из них:
- Flexbox — мощный CSS-модуль, который позволяет легко управлять расположением элементов на странице. С помощью флексбокса можно легко создавать гибкие и адаптивные макеты.
- Grid — еще один CSS-модуль, который предоставляет инструменты для создания сеток. С его помощью можно легко размещать элементы на странице в виде сетки с разными размерами и расстояниями между ними.
- Адаптивная верстка — это подход, который позволяет создавать веб-сайты, которые автоматически адаптируются к разным экранам и устройствам. При адаптивной верстке используются медиазапросы и относительные единицы измерения, чтобы элементы страницы масштабировались и перестраивались при изменении размера окна браузера.
- Анимации и переходы — с помощью CSS и JavaScript можно добавить анимации и переходы к разным элементам на странице. Это может быть полезно для создания интерактивных и привлекательных веб-сайтов.
- Веб-шрифты — с помощью CSS можно подключать и использовать различные веб-шрифты на веб-сайте. Это позволяет использовать более необычные и стильные шрифты, которые не входят в стандартные наборы шрифтов.
- Трансформации и фильтры — с помощью CSS можно применять различные трансформации (повороты, масштабирование, смещение) и фильтры (насыщенность, размытие, яркость) к элементам на странице. Это позволяет создавать интересные и эффектные визуальные эффекты.
Это только некоторые из продвинутых техник верстки, которые можно изучить и применить при создании веб-сайтов. Их использование может значительно улучшить внешний вид и функциональность веб-сайта.
Макеты и сетки
Веб-страницы делятся на различные секции и блоки. Для их размещения используются макеты и сетки.
Макет — это общая структура, которая определяет расположение различных элементов на странице. Макет помогает создать целостное и удобное взаимодействие пользователя с сайтом.
Сетка — это структура, которая помогает выровнять и распределить элементы на странице. Сетка может быть регулярной или не регулярной, в зависимости от особенностей дизайна.
Существуют различные типы сеток. Одним из наиболее популярных типов является колоночная сетка. Она представляет собой горизонтальные и вертикальные линии, которые разделяют страницу на ряды и колонки. Колоночные сетки облегчают размещение и выравнивание содержимого.
Колоночные сетки могут быть фиксированными или адаптивными. Фиксированные сетки имеют фиксированную ширину, что означает, что они не изменяются при изменении размера окна браузера. Адаптивные сетки, напротив, изменяются в зависимости от размера экрана. Это улучшает отображение страницы на разных устройствах.
С помощью сеток можно создавать различные макеты, такие как одноколоночный, двухколоночный, трехколоночный и т.д. Каждый макет имеет свои особенности и применение в зависимости от целей и задач сайта.
Использование макетов и сеток помогает создавать эстетичные, понятные и удобные для пользователя веб-страницы. При верстке следует учитывать принципы дизайна и выравнивания, чтобы создать гармоничный и профессиональный внешний вид сайта.
Адаптивная верстка
Адаптивная верстка — это методология разработки веб-страниц, которая позволяет им отображаться корректно на различных устройствах и экранах, включая настольные компьютеры, планшеты и мобильные телефоны.
Основной принцип адаптивной верстки заключается в том, чтобы создать универсальное и гибкое веб-приложение, которое автоматически адаптируется к размеру и разрешению экрана устройства пользователя.
Для достижения адаптивности веб-страницы используется медиа-запросы, которые позволяют задавать определенные стили и правила для конкретных условий экрана, таких как ширина и ориентация экрана.
Один из популярных подходов в адаптивной верстке — «мобильный в первую очередь» (mobile first), при котором сначала разрабатывается мобильная версия веб-страницы, а затем уже добавляются стили и элементы для настольных компьютеров.
Другим подходом является «постепенное улучшение» (progressive enhancement), при котором базовая функциональность веб-страницы доступна на всех устройствах, а затем добавляются дополнительные стили и элементы для более крупных устройств.
Адаптивная верстка позволяет создавать более удобный и доступный пользовательский интерфейс, улучшает восприятие контента и увеличивает конверсию на разных устройствах. Она также упрощает разработку и поддержку веб-приложения, так как требуется лишь одна версия кода для всех устройств.
В итоге, адаптивная верстка — это неотъемлемая часть современной веб-разработки, которая позволяет создавать универсальные и гибкие веб-страницы, которые будут корректно отображаться на всех устройствах и экранах.
Веб-разработка
Веб-разработка — это процесс создания и поддержки веб-сайтов и веб-приложений. Веб-разработка включает в себя несколько этапов, включая фронтенд-разработку, бэкенд-разработку и дизайн.
Фронтенд-разработка отвечает за создание пользовательского интерфейса веб-сайта. Фронтенд-разработчики используют HTML, CSS и JavaScript для создания визуальной части сайта. Они также отвечают за оптимизацию сайта для улучшения его производительности и доступности.
Бэкенд-разработка отвечает за создание серверной части веб-сайта. Бэкенд-разработчики используют различные языки программирования, такие как PHP, Python или Ruby, для создания логики и функциональности сайта. Они работают с базами данных, обрабатывают данные и управляют сервером.
Дизайн играет важную роль в веб-разработке. Дизайнеры создают эстетически привлекательные и удобные в использовании интерфейсы для пользователей. Они также работают над разработкой общего концепта и визуального стиля веб-сайта.
Для организации работы над веб-разработкой широко используются системы контроля версий, такие как Git, а также среды разработки, такие как Visual Studio Code. Эти инструменты позволяют разработчикам эффективно совместно работать над проектами.
Веб-разработчики часто используют различные фреймворки и библиотеки, которые упрощают и ускоряют процесс разработки. Некоторые популярные фреймворки для фронтенд-разработки включают Bootstrap и React, а для бэкенд-разработки — Django и Express.
Веб-разработка предоставляет множество возможностей для творчества и профессионального роста, поскольку веб-сайты и приложения играют все более важную роль в нашей современной жизни.
Вопрос-ответ
Какую тему освещает книга Уильямс Р «Верстка для начинающих»?
В книге Уильямса Р «Верстка для начинающих» освещается тема основ верстки и веб-дизайна, а также рассматриваются практические навыки работы с HTML, CSS и JavaScript.
Для какого уровня читателей предназначена книга Уильямс Р «Верстка для начинающих»?
Книга Уильямс Р «Верстка для начинающих» предназначена для начинающих веб-разработчиков и тех, кто хочет освоить основы верстки и веб-дизайна.
Что включает в себя книга Уильямс Р «Верстка для начинающих»?
Книга Уильямс Р «Верстка для начинающих» включает в себя материал по основам HTML, CSS и JavaScript, а также рассматривает различные техники верстки, создания адаптивного дизайна и оптимизации сайтов.
Можно ли использовать книгу Уильямс Р «Верстка для начинающих» для самостоятельного обучения?
Да, книгу Уильямс Р «Верстка для начинающих» можно использовать для самостоятельного обучения. В ней представлено достаточно подробное описание основных концепций и примеры кода, что позволяет начинающим разработчикам учиться самостоятельно.